I'm sending OSSEC logs via syslog. All OSSEC logs are indexed and can be found using search, but all OSSEC dashboards are empty. Why is that?

0 Karma
1 Solution

ozirus
Path Finder

In your ossec.conf, please make sure that your log format is default not splunk or any other thing.

This is correct. The "splunk" option in ossec.conf was added by someone else long after the Splunk management app for OSSEC was written, and it does not follow the same logic. Counterintuitive though it may seem, using the "splunk" output option in ossec.conf is not recommended.

The other common source of this problem is if sourcetype is not set correctly for the incoming OSSEC logs.
